The Unior 617031 screwdriver set includes seven chrome-plated screwdrivers with TX (Torx) profile designed for driving and loosening Torx fasteners. The set covers a range of Torx sizes commonly used in workshop, assembly and maintenance tasks and is intended for precise engagement with Torx screw heads. Handles and blades are matched to provide consistent torque transfer and reliable fit during repeated use.
The chrome finish on the blades offers corrosion resistance and easier cleaning. The TX profile tips are machined to fit Torx fasteners accurately, reducing cam-out and wear on both tool and screw. A selection of seven sizes in one compact set reduces the need to change tools during jobs and supports faster workflow. The screwdrivers are suitable for both professional and hobby applications where precise Torx engagement is required.
Select the Torx size that matches the screw head and insert the tip fully into the screw recess to ensure proper seating. Apply steady axial pressure and turn the handle with controlled force to drive or remove the fastener. Avoid using the screwdrivers as pry bars or chisels and do not apply impact force unless the tool is specifically rated for it. After use, wipe blades clean of debris and store the set in a dry place to preserve the chrome finish.
Use the correctly sized TX screwdriver to minimise fastener and tip damage; when working in electronics or delicate assemblies, apply light torque and consider anti-static precautions. Regular inspection of tips for deformation will extend tool life.
